Business Analyst (Hybrid – Birmingham 2 Days/Week)

Location: Birmingham, West Midlands (Hybrid – 2-3 days on-site per week)

Salary to 50-55k plus excellent benefits

This client based out of Birmingham is looking for a talented BA to join their dynamic team and play a pivotal role in shaping the future of their IT and business operations.

The Role

As a Business Analyst, you\’ll evaluate and improve business processes, deliver impactful IT solutions, and drive operational efficiency across enterprise-critical systems. This role is ideal for a BA with 4 years’ experience, hands-on knowledge of Microsoft technologies, a strong analytical mindset, and excellent stakeholder management skills.

Core Responsibilities

  • Evaluate and analyze existing business processes to identify inefficiencies and areas for improvement.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ams and stakeholders to capture and document business requirements.
  • Propose and support the implementation of IT solutions aligned with business goals and customer satisfaction.
  • Lead and manage IT projects from concept to delivery, ensuring adherence to timelines, budgets, and quality standards.
  • Leverage data analytics to support evidence-based decision-making and performance insights.
  • Maintain clear and effective communication with all stakeholders, including senior leadership.

Key Experience & Skills

  • Proven experience as a Business Analyst, ideally 4 years within the financial sector.
  • Strong knowledge of business analysis tools, methodologies, and project management frameworks.
  • Hands-on experience with Microsoft Technologies, including Azure, Microsoft 365, and enterprise system migrations.
  • Proficiency in data analytics tools to derive actionable insights.
  • Certifications such as CBAP, PMP, or ITIL are preferred, along with a strong understanding of business process modeling and project lifecycle management.

This is a great opportunity for a Business Analyst to lead high-impact projects within a collaborative, forward-thinking team culture.

We think this is how you could land Business Analyst

✨Tip Number 1

Familiarise yourself with the specific Microsoft technologies mentioned in the job description, such as Azure and Microsoft 365. Being able to discuss your hands-on experience with these tools during the interview will demonstrate your suitability for the role.

✨Tip Number 2

Prepare examples of how you've successfully evaluated and improved business processes in your previous roles.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ses, making it easier for interviewers to understand your impact.

✨Tip Number 3

Research the company’s recent projects or initiatives related to IT solutions and operational efficiency. This knowledge will allow you to ask insightful questions during the interview and show that you're genuinely interested in contributing to their goals.

✨Tip Number 4

Network with current or former employees on platforms like LinkedIn. Engaging with them can provide valuable insights into the company culture and expectations, which you can leverage to tailor your approach during the interview process.
